How does Mill's conception of higher and lower pleasures affect his utilitarianism?

Mill's concept of higher and lower pleasures introduces a qualitative dimension to utilitarianism. Higher pleasures refer to intellectual and moral pursuits which he considered superior to lower, more base physical pleasures. This distinction affects moral decision-making by suggesting that actions should aim at promoting higher pleasures for individuals, thus enriching life beyond mere physical gratification and influencing complex ethical evaluations.
